(PR)  My Arcade, the industry leader in retro video gaming, is thrilled to reintroduce the Super RetroChamp at CES 2025, delivering the ultimate portable console for retro enthusiasts. Originally revealed at CES 2020, the Super RetroChamp quickly gained an enduring following on social media, and after overwhelming fan demand, it’s finally here to reignite the retro gaming experience.

The Super RetroChamp is designed for collectors and players looking to enjoy their favorite retro cartridges in a modern, portable format. With its ability to play Super NES (SNES) and SEGA Genesis cartridges, the Super RetroChamp delivers a versatile, nostalgia-packed gaming experience.

Key Features

  • Multi-Cartridge Compatibility: Supports original SNES and SEGA Genesis cartridges. Also supports Super Famicom and Mega Drive cartridges.
  • Built-in Display: Vibrant 6″ full-color screen
  • TV Connectivity: HDMI output for TV connection to enjoy classic games on the big screen.
  • Portable Power: Built-in rechargeable battery for hours of uninterrupted gameplay.
  • Fan-Inspired Revival: Developed in response to overwhelming fan demand
  • Item Number: DGUN-3943
  • Item Number: $149.99
